CHURCH THEME 2025:
ABUNDANT LIFE

 “I have come that they may have life and have it to the full.”
— John 10:10b (NIV) 

Key Theological Foundations

“I came that they may have life.”
 

  • Audience: Beyond PLCMC members, “they” encompasses individuals in the church’s neighbourhood and personal networks who have yet to know Christ.
     

  • Mission: Extend the invitation to experience life through Christ.
     

“And have it abundantly.”
 

  • Growth Focus: Holistic development in Christian living, from loving God to serving neighbours.
     

  • Scriptural Call: “Live a life worthy of your calling—be humble, gentle, patient, bearing with one another in love.” — Ephesians 4:1-2 (NIV)

Practical Application: John Wesley’s Principles


“Earn all you can! Save all you can! Give all you can!”

 

  • Biblical Stewardship: Maintain a healthy balance regarding wealth, recognizing God’s provision for personal needs and His kingdom’s advancement.
     

  • Abundant Life Covenant: Financial wisdom and generosity are integral to experiencing God’s abundance.

Symbolism of Liturgical Colours
 

The five coloured circles in the theme design reflect:
 

  1. Liturgical Tradition: Alignment with historical church seasons (e.g. purple for penitence, white for celebration).
     

  2. Daily Experiences: Representation of life’s diverse and vibrant journey.
     

  3. Biblical Meaning: Colours hold scriptural significance (e.g. red for sacrifice, green for growth).
